Greetings. I have a 1986 Johnson 110hp that I recently picked up. I deleted the VRO and mix oil with the gas. I have an alarm that goes off within a minute of starting the motor. It's not a constant beep but it's intermittent. The alarm comes from behind the steering wheel in the helm compartment. Is that going off due to the VRO being bypassed? I replaced the impeller, thermostats and pop-up valves, all of which looked good. Water seems to be circulating fine. I don't believe it's overheating but I'm going to put a thermal tester on it later today to verify that. Hoping the alarm is due to the VRO bypass and I can just disconnect it. Thinking that if it was an overheating alarm it would be constant and not intermittent. Thoughts?
